Season 17 of the Major Series of Poker: The Tour (MSPT) will continue this week, Feb. 10-16, at JACK Cleveland Casino with the Ohio Poker State Championship.
The stop features six Gold Card events, including Tag Team, Seniors, PLO, NLH Monster Stack, and a special $400 buy-in, $50K GTD President’s Day tournament.
However, the cornerstone tournament is the $1,110 MSPT Ohio Poker State Championship, which boasts a $750,000 guarantee. That tournament will kick off with Day 1A at 3:15 p.m. local time on Thursday, Feb. 12. Players will start with 30,000 in chips, play 40-minute levels, and late registration will remain open until just past midnight.
Day 1B will then take place at 12:15 p.m. on Friday, Feb. 13 (late reg open until 9:40 p.m.) with Day 1C at the same time on Saturday, Feb. 14. The surviving players from all three flights will then combine at 11:15 a.m. on Sunday, Feb. 15 for Day 2 action and to play down to a winner.

Right after Cleveland, the MSPT will head to Milwaukee’s Potawatomi Casino for the Club Poker Championship from Feb. 17-22. That tournament boasts a $1,000,000 guarantee and is expected to draw thousands of players from across the Midwest.
After that, it’s the MSPT Festival at Grand Falls Casino in Larchwood, Iowa – which is situated just outside Sioux Falls, South Dakota – from March 11-15, followed by the MSPT Festival at Iowa’s Riverside Casino from March 17-22.
Finally, March will wrap up with the MSPT Missouri Poker State Championship at Ameristar Casino St. Charles in St. Louis.

MSPT Gold Cards
For every side event with a $200 buy-in and above, the MSPT has introduced coveted Gold Cards.
MSPT Gold Cards are awarded to winners of MSPT Series events. These Cards are highly coveted by poker players and represent a significant accomplishment in the poker world, representing skill and success.
The custom, gorgeous, and premium MSPT Gold Cards are produced using Gold Foil by Faded Spade – the Gold Standard of Playing Cards in the poker industry – designed specifically for MSPT by one of the best artists in the country, Joel Jensen, and are displayed and awarded in a Graded Card Case.
The first Gold Card won will be the custom Ace of Spades, the second will be the 2 of Spades, the third will be the 3 of Spades, and so on. After win 13, the next suit will be presented. The race for the most MSPT Gold Cards is sure to be competitive, with the addition of the new Gold Card Leaderboard as well as the number of Gold Cards won displayed with each player’s MSPT profile.
